JOB SUMMARY
This job is responsible for ownership of one or more aspects of the application product life cycle, including but not limited to product strategy, planning/road mapping, market competitive positioning, defining the customer value proposition, budgetary management, design, development, delivery, and support. Includes partnering with business stakeholders, collaborating with peers, leading cross functional teams, and managing vendors. Regularly engages with Planning and Design, Architecture, Platform Operations, Product Development and Management, Product Maintenance, Consulting Services, Infrastructure, and Marketing teams to enhance product offering and delivery. Strong focus on software development and operational excellence using Agile and Lean practices to create market differentiated solutions. Ensures outcomes are compliant, high quality, available, reliable, effective, and secure.
